VE53 HDL is a 2003 Citroen Picasso in Silver with a 1,749c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.4%.
Across all 2003 Citroen Picasso models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.4% with a typical mileage of 70,024 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en Picasso f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 230 recorded failures. If you're considering buying VE53 HDL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en Picasso typ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 23 years old, this Citroen Picasso is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
